Wood siding replacement services involve removing damaged, rotting, or outdated wood siding and installing new panels to enhance the appearance and integrity of a property’s exterior. The process typically includes carefully removing the existing siding, preparing the underlying wall surfaces, and installing new wood panels that match the original style or a desired update. This service often requires attention to detail to ensure proper sealing, alignment, and finishing, which helps maintain the building’s structural stability and curb appeal.
One of the primary issues that wood siding replacement addresses is deterioration caused by weather exposure, moisture intrusion, or pest damage. Over time, wood siding can develop rot, warping, cracks, or insect infestations, which compromise the protective barrier of the home or building. Replacing compromised siding helps prevent further structural problems, reduces the risk of water damage, and improves insulation. Additionally, it can revitalize the overall look of a property, making it appear well-maintained and visually appealing.

Material and Size Costs - The cost to replace wood siding varies based on the type of wood and the size of the area. Typically, expenses range from $3,000 to $10,000 for a standard home in Clinton, MA. Larger or custom projects may cost more depending on material choices.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for wood siding replacement usually account for about 50% to 70% of the total project price. For a typical home, labor can range from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ity and accessibility of the job.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include removal of old siding, surface preparation, and finishing touches. These can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ost, varying with project scope and site conditions.
Cost Factors - Factors influencing costs include siding style, quality of materials, and local labor rates. Variations in project size and specific site requirements can cause the total expense to fluctuate significantly.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my wood siding needs to be replaced? Signs such as rotting, warping, cracking, or extensive peeling paint may indicate the need for replacement. A professional contractor can assess the condition of the siding to determine if replacement is necessary.
What are common reasons for replacing wood siding? Common reasons include damage from moisture, pests, age-related deterioration, or outdated appearance that may benefit from an upgrade.
How long does wood siding repl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the size of the project and weather conditions, but a local contractor can provide an estimated timeline during the consultation.
Are there different types of wood siding options available? Yes, options include cedar, pine, redwood, and engineered wood, each with different styles and durability characteristics that a professional can help select.
